Update: February 24, 2025 Back at Goodfellas and hubby along with me. I photographed his Chicken Fingers and my side salad. I was craving the Buffalo Chicken Wrap, again, so did not take that photo. Nice crowd. We played some good music on TouchTunes. We got lots of compliments on our selections from the 60', 70's, and 80's -- Rock and Roll, of course. If you have not tried Goodfellas, yet, get yourself on over there! Original Review Have been coming to Lexington's Goodfellas restaurant on US 1 for a few years. Realized I had not posted about it yet. Headed to the bar to catch some of the lunchtime sports on the multiple TV's throught the room. TouchTunes available here. Like the local casual atmosphere. Nice selection of salads, sandwiches, burgers, wraps, wings, and meat and veg specials. Restaurant has a good-sized bar with bistro tables and booth seating on one side, as well as all dining seating on the other. Today, I started with an appetizer not tried before, Pimento Cheese Fritters with a sweet dipping sauce. A Bloody Mary was the perfect accompaniment with the fritters. These fritters are crispy golden outside and yummy, gooey inside. Really good! The main meal was the Buffalo Chicken Wrap with a side of Collard Greens. The wrap had just the right amount of heat in the Buffalo sauce, covering those juicy slices of fried chicken. I usually do fries or wing chips but opted to squeeze in a vegetable today. Large parking lot.

My sister and I stopped in for lunch around 2 PM on a Friday. They have a self-seating system, and we were promptly greeted by a server who provided friendly, attentive service throughout our meal. We ordered a margarita and its blue variation, both of which were refreshing and fun to try. For our entrees, we went with a ribeye and the hamburger steak…both were cooked to perfection and expertly prepared. We paired these with sides of collard greens, mashed potatoes, and a side salad. All of the sides were delicious, but the mashed potatoes and collards were the standout—homemade and honestly some of the best I’ve had dining out. The portions were generous, and the pricing was extremely fair. A late lunch with leftovers for dinner reasonably totaled at $66! It was well worth it in every sense. The menu offers a variety of options to satisfy any palate, and we’d definitely return soon. PS for anyone who may be particular…the AC WORKS in this joint! Great spot to beat the heat.
